![]() Double glazing can enhance the appearance of your home and increase energy efficiency. It also provides a range of other benefits, including noise reduction and security. Double glazing can be a source of problems that need to be fixed. Troubles can arise from foggy windows condensation between panes as well as leaks, draughts, and draughts. Broken panes Glass breakage is a part of the home ownership. A lawnmowers blade could throw a pebble or a cup could be dropped onto the window sill. Cats can cry and cause the glass to shatter. If you have single-pane or double hlazing pane windows, it is important to get them fixed as soon as possible. The longer you leave a broken window and it gets worse, the more damaged it will become. This is because the seals will wear down and deteriorate. This could lead to an increase in your energy costs, condensation and more. If a window is damaged and needs to be replaced, it is recommended to call in the experts for resealing instead of trying to do it yourself. It is challenging to reseal an window without the proper tools and techniques. Window experts can quickly fix a damaged seal, making your windows more efficient and reducing your energy costs. If you have double glazing windows repairs pane windows, it's crucial to replace both panes if one breaks. Double pane windows are made with a space between the two glass panels that is filled with inert gas such as argon and krypton. This prevents heat and cool air from venting out, and reduces the flow of heat. Repairing a double-pane window by replacing just the damaged pane could cause damage to the entire assembly and cause damage to the functionality of your windows. To replace a window begin by ensuring that the window is level on the ground. Put on a pair of thick cut-proof gloves and safety glasses and carefully remove the old glass. Scrape off any paint or varnish on the wooden frames after taking off the old glazing. Once the frame is prepared to receive windows, carefully determine the opening size and then cut the piece of glass to size. It is recommended to purchase the glass a little smaller than the opening you want to ensure it fits within the frame. The next step is to cement the glass in place using the glazier's points and putty. Then, apply grout that is not sanded to the edges and corners of the pane to prevent it from cracking or chipping in the future. Misted panes Double glazing can improve the aesthetics of your home and leave a lasting impression on your guests. It can also make your home more energy-efficient and act as a noise diffuser. If the glass panes begin to fog up or mist, they can be unsightly and interfere with your view. Fortunately, this issue can be resolved with a few simple steps. The most common cause of foggy windows is condensation. It is a normal occurrence that occurs when warm air is brought into contact with cool air. The air will turn into water vapour and will condense on cold surfaces of your home. This will most likely occur on your windows, mirrors and even furniture. However, when it happens between double-glazed windows, it's typically caused by a leaky seal. It can be fixed or replaced to stop the issue from happening again. The windows that are stained with water can be a danger. The water that gets trapped in the windows that are insulated could cause dampness, and possibly mold in your house. Therefore, it's important to fix the issue when you notice it. Dehumidifiers and increased ventilation are two of the most effective methods to stop condensation. It's also a good idea to regularly clean your windows to remove any dust or dirt that may be causing them to become cloudy. Sometimes, the best option is to employ a double glazing repair service who can repair or replace your windows. A professional will use a hot-melt sealant in order to create a gap that is sealed between the two panes of glass on your windows. The gap is then filled with regular air or argon gas to improve the thermal efficiency of your home. The spacer is also typically made up of an desiccant material which helps to absorb any moisture in the air. If you notice condensation growing up inside your double glazed windows this is a sign that the seal has failed or double glazing windows repairs that the desiccant has been saturated with moisture. Leaks Double glazing is usually designed to last 20-35 years, or more However, ensuring that it lasts for this long is contingent on the correct installation from the beginning and regular maintenance thereafter. The sealant that holds window panes together can sometimes get damaged. This can cause leaks around the edges of the window. Fortunately it is a simple issue that can be fixed with a quick repair. Leaking is typically caused by a damaged seal, but it can also be caused by damp weather or an old, damaged door or window. When this happens, water will get into the frame and can lead to mold and rot. This is a common problem with older homes, but can also happen in newer homes where the materials used in the construction aren't as moisture-resistant as they might be. The best way to test for leaks is to feel at the edges of the frame at the point where it joins the brickwork. If you feel a draft, then the sealant has deteriorated and needs to be replaced. Condensation is another common problem. It's common in kitchens and bathrooms, where there is a lot of moisture. It can also occur on cold surfaces like windows. It's not normally a problem in itself, but it could be an indication that the seal between two glass panes has developed a leak, which can cause gas leaks between the two panes. Condensation can be prevented by ensuring the room is ventilated by using extractors or leaving the windows open to help reduce humidity. It can also be prevented by regularly cleaning the weep holes in the window frames, in order to prevent them from becoming clogged with dust. Make sure that your double glazing comes with a warranty. If it is, you should contact the company that installed it and inform them of any issues. You should not attempt to alter the window units, or fix them yourself. This could void the warranty. |
